1973 Honda 145 vs. 1982 Opel Ascona

To start off, 1982 Opel Ascona is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Honda 145.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Honda 145 would be higher. At 1,433 cc (4 cylinders), 1973 Honda 145 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1982 Opel Ascona (75 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 7 more horse power than 1973 Honda 145. (68 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1982 Opel Ascona should accelerate faster than 1973 Honda 145.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1982 Opel Ascona weights approximately 70 kg more than 1973 Honda 145.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1973 Honda 145 (118 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 17 more torque (in Nm) than 1982 Opel Ascona. (101 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 1973 Honda 145 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1982 Opel Ascona. 1982 Opel Ascona has automatic transmission and 1973 Honda 145 has manual transmission. 1973 Honda 145 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1982 Opel Ascona will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1973 Honda 145 1982 Opel Ascona
Make Honda Opel
Model 145 Ascona
Year Released 1973 1982
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1433 cc 1295 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 68 HP 75 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 5800 RPM
Torque 118 Nm 101 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 3800 RPM
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Vehicle Weight 920 kg 990 kg
Vehicle Length 4150 mm 4270 mm
Vehicle Width 1500 mm 1670 mm
Vehicle Height 1340 mm 1370 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 2580 mm
